On 2/6/25 16:00, Ted Chen wrote:
> Remove the two unnecessary comments around vxlan_rcv() and
> vxlan_err_lookup(), which indicate that the callers are from
> net/ipv{4,6}/udp.c. These callers are trivial to find. Additionally, the
> comment for vxlan_rcv() missed that the caller could also be from
> net/ipv6/udp.c.
